Types of Jobs Available in Precious Metals
There are many different jobs available in the precious metals industry. Some of the most common positions are:- Mining and Exploration – Mining and exploration companies are responsible for locating and extracting precious metals from the earth. This includes drilling, mapping, and surveying.
- Refining and Smelting – Once the metals have been extracted, they must be refined and smelted in order to make them usable. This requires specialized equipment and chemical knowledge.
- Manufacturing – Precious metals are used to make jewelry, coins, and other items. Those who work in manufacturing are responsible for turning raw materials into finished products.
- Trading and Investing – Trading and investing in precious metals is a popular way to make money. Those who work in this field must have a keen eye for spotting market trends.
- Retail – Precious metals are sold in retail stores, both online and in person. Those who work in retail must be knowledgeable about the different types of metals and products they are selling.
Qualifications Needed for Precious Metals Jobs
The qualifications needed for jobs in the precious metals industry vary depending on the position. Generally speaking, the following qualifications are required:- A college degree in a related field such as geology, chemistry, or engineering.
- Experience in the industry, either through an internship or apprenticeship.
- Knowledge of the different types of precious metals and their uses.
- Understanding of the market and the different trading and investing strategies.
- Excellent communication and customer service skills.
- Strong problem-solving and analytical skills.
